Why I sold my Fjallraven Kanken bag

Not too long ago, I was obsessed with the Fjallraven Kanken bag that I’m sure you have seen around – either in media or on the streets. I bought my bag through ilovemykanken which is now part of the official Fjallraven brand and website. I bought it online as it wasn’t available in stores yet.

There was so many colours available but I was debating against the “Fog” or the “Putty”. In a simple man’s eye, they’re both grey in colour, haha. I ended up with “Fog”. The delivery time actually took really long, about 2 months due to some delivery delays when it was estimated to come within 2 weeks max.

I loved the bag and the colour when it first arrived. Little did I know that it would end up collecting dust in my room. I actually used this bag when I went to Japan two summers ago.

But then I found out while wearing it more that the boxy shape of the bag didn’t fit my body right and I feel like it’s too big, as I’m quite petite. Perhaps if I had chosen the Laptop 13″ size instead of the Classic, it might have fit better.

I had done research about the straps and it wasn’t supposed to hurt but it felt uncomfortable to me everytime I wore the bag. I also didn’t like how floppy and unstructured the bag was in person. In pictures, it always looks so structured. I just simply didn’t like my purchase as much as I thought I would. 🙁

It was pure luck and coincidence that someone I knew was looking into this bag and since mine was collecting dust, I sold my bag to her. I really did wanted to like this bag, but I guess it wasn’t meant to be.
